django中怎么創(chuàng)建用戶(hù)
一、用戶(hù)模型 Django提供了默認(rèn)的用戶(hù)模型(User Model),可以直接使用或者自定義擴(kuò)展。用戶(hù)模型包含了常見(jiàn)的字段,如用戶(hù)名、密碼、電子郵件等。 二、創(chuàng)建用戶(hù) 在Django中創(chuàng)建
一、用戶(hù)模型
Django提供了默認(rèn)的用戶(hù)模型(User Model),可以直接使用或者自定義擴(kuò)展。用戶(hù)模型包含了常見(jiàn)的字段,如用戶(hù)名、密碼、電子郵件等。
二、創(chuàng)建用戶(hù)
在Django中創(chuàng)建用戶(hù)非常簡(jiǎn)單,可以通過(guò)調(diào)用`create_user()`方法或者使用管理員命令行工具來(lái)進(jìn)行。
三、用戶(hù)認(rèn)證
Django提供了多種用戶(hù)認(rèn)證方式,包括用戶(hù)名密碼認(rèn)證、第三方登錄認(rèn)證等。可以根據(jù)需求選擇適合的認(rèn)證方式。
四、用戶(hù)權(quán)限
Django提供了靈活的用戶(hù)權(quán)限控制機(jī)制,可以通過(guò)設(shè)置用戶(hù)組和權(quán)限來(lái)實(shí)現(xiàn)不同角色的訪(fǎng)問(wèn)權(quán)限控制。
總結(jié):
本文詳細(xì)介紹了Django中用戶(hù)的創(chuàng)建和管理,包括用戶(hù)模型、創(chuàng)建用戶(hù)、用戶(hù)認(rèn)證和用戶(hù)權(quán)限控制。通過(guò)本文的學(xué)習(xí),讀者可以深入了解Django中用戶(hù)相關(guān)的功能和操作方式,從而在實(shí)際項(xiàng)目中更好地應(yīng)用和管理用戶(hù)。